Here are your spoilers for The Young and the Restless episode for Friday, October 17, 2025.
What's next on The Young and the Restless

At times, Jack may feel more like Billy's father than his older brother. He's backed his younger brother's business venture (Abbott Communications) and tried to steer him away from getting revenge on Victor Newman (Eric Braeden), pointing out that that never works out well!
On Friday's show, watch for Jack to clear the air with Billy. Is Billy finally going to make peace with the fact that his brother drew a line in the sand with him? Or will this encounter cause Billy to continue to feel uneasy?
Nick of time

Nick (Joshua Morrow) may be feeling powerless over his son Noah's (Lucas Adams) health. He's been in a horrific car accident, and details of that accident have come to light. Noah's car wreck was no accident!
Nick is never at his most passionate than when he's concerned about the safety and welfare of his family. On Friday's show, watch for Nick to search for answers. He's going to want to make sure that his son's attacker is brought to justice and will be unable to harm Noah or anyone else ever again. Noah's assailants will likely feel like they've been hit by a car once Nick gets a hold of them!
Ouch, Audra

Audra Charles (Zuleyka Silver) was hoping to make a fresh start when she came to Genoa City. Outside of her friendships with Sally (Courtney Hope) and Amy (Valarie Pettiford), Sally hasn't had much luck in doing that. She struck out with Victor (Eric Braeden), who teased funding Vibrante, Audra's startup, if Audra managed to break up Kyle (Michael Mealor) and Claire (Hayley Erin). Technically, Audra indirectly helped divide them, given Claire's reaction to the actions Kyle took to expose her.
Things are about to get worse for Audra on Friday's episode when she receives a painful reminder about her past. Will Audra let this reminder give up or fight even harder? We suspect the latter, but tune in to find out!
